Partilhar via


ListView.ColumnHeaderCollection.Insert Método

Definição

Insere um cabeçalho de coluna na coleção no índice especificado.

Sobrecargas

Nome Description
Insert(Int32, String, String, Int32, HorizontalAlignment, String)

Cria um novo cabeçalho de coluna com o texto, a chave, a largura e a chave de imagem alinhados especificados e insere o cabeçalho na coleção no índice especificado.

Insert(Int32, String, String, Int32, HorizontalAlignment, Int32)

Cria um novo cabeçalho de coluna com o texto, a chave, a largura e o índice de imagem alinhados especificados e insere o cabeçalho na coleção no índice especificado.

Insert(Int32, String, Int32, HorizontalAlignment)

Cria um novo cabeçalho de coluna e insere-o na coleção no índice especificado.

Insert(Int32, String, String, Int32)

Cria um novo cabeçalho de coluna com o texto, a chave e a largura especificados e insere o cabeçalho na coleção no índice especificado.

Insert(Int32, String, String)

Cria um novo cabeçalho de coluna com o texto e a chave especificados e insere o cabeçalho na coleção no índice especificado.

Insert(Int32, String, Int32)

Cria um novo cabeçalho de coluna com o texto especificado e a largura inicial e insere o cabeçalho na coleção no índice especificado.

Insert(Int32, ColumnHeader)

Insere um cabeçalho de coluna existente na coleção no índice especificado.

Insert(Int32, String)

Cria um novo cabeçalho de coluna com o texto especificado e insere o cabeçalho na coleção no índice especificado.

Insert(Int32, String, String, Int32, HorizontalAlignment, String)

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s

Cria um novo cabeçalho de coluna com o texto, a chave, a largura e a chave de imagem alinhados especificados e insere o cabeçalho na coleção no índice especificado.

public:
 void Insert(int index, System::String ^ key, System::String ^ text, int width, System::Windows::Forms::HorizontalAlignment textAlign, System::String ^ imageKey);
public void Insert(int index, string key, string text, int width, System.Windows.Forms.HorizontalAlignment textAlign, string imageKey);
member this.Insert : int * string * string * int * System.Windows.Forms.HorizontalAlignment * string -> unit
Public Sub Insert (index As Integer, key As String, text As String, width As Integer, textAlign As HorizontalAlignment, imageKey As String)

Parâmetros

index
Int32

O local do índice baseado em zero em que o cabeçalho da coluna é inserido.

key
String

O nome do cabeçalho da coluna.

text
String

O texto a ser exibido no cabeçalho da coluna.

width
Int32

A largura inicial, em pixels, do cabeçalho da coluna.

textAlign
HorizontalAlignment

Um dos HorizontalAlignment valores.

imageKey
String

A chave da imagem a ser exibida no cabeçalho da coluna.

Comentários

Para adicionar um cabeçalho de coluna sem especificar uma posição na coleção, use o Add método. Se você quiser adicionar uma matriz de cabeçalhos de coluna à coleção, use o AddRange método.

A Name propriedade corresponde à chave de uma coluna no ListView.ColumnHeaderCollection.

Aplica-se a

Insert(Int32, String, String, Int32, HorizontalAlignment, Int32)

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s

Cria um novo cabeçalho de coluna com o texto, a chave, a largura e o índice de imagem alinhados especificados e insere o cabeçalho na coleção no índice especificado.

public:
 void Insert(int index, System::String ^ key, System::String ^ text, int width, System::Windows::Forms::HorizontalAlignment textAlign, int imageIndex);
public void Insert(int index, string key, string text, int width, System.Windows.Forms.HorizontalAlignment textAlign, int imageIndex);
member this.Insert : int * string * string * int * System.Windows.Forms.HorizontalAlignment * int -> unit
Public Sub Insert (index As Integer, key As String, text As String, width As Integer, textAlign As HorizontalAlignment, imageIndex As Integer)

Parâmetros

index
Int32

O local do índice baseado em zero em que o cabeçalho da coluna é inserido.

key
String

O nome do cabeçalho da coluna.

text
String

O texto a ser exibido no cabeçalho da coluna.

width
Int32

A largura inicial, em pixels, do cabeçalho da coluna.

textAlign
HorizontalAlignment

Um dos HorizontalAlignment valores.

imageIndex
Int32

O índice da imagem a ser exibida no cabeçalho da coluna.

Comentários

Para adicionar um cabeçalho de coluna sem especificar uma posição na coleção, use o Add método. Se você quiser adicionar uma matriz de cabeçalhos de coluna à coleção, use o AddRange método.

A Name propriedade corresponde à chave de uma coluna no ListView.ColumnHeaderCollection.

Aplica-se a

Insert(Int32, String, Int32, HorizontalAlignment)

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s

Cria um novo cabeçalho de coluna e insere-o na coleção no índice especificado.

public:
 void Insert(int index, System::String ^ str, int width, System::Windows::Forms::HorizontalAlignment textAlign);
public:
 void Insert(int index, System::String ^ text, int width, System::Windows::Forms::HorizontalAlignment textAlign);
public void Insert(int index, string str, int width, System.Windows.Forms.HorizontalAlignment textAlign);
public void Insert(int index, string text, int width, System.Windows.Forms.HorizontalAlignment textAlign);
member this.Insert : int * string * int * System.Windows.Forms.HorizontalAlignment -> unit
member this.Insert : int * string * int * System.Windows.Forms.HorizontalAlignment -> unit
Public Sub Insert (index As Integer, str As String, width As Integer, textAlign As HorizontalAlignment)
Public Sub Insert (index As Integer, text As String, width As Integer, textAlign As HorizontalAlignment)

Parâmetros

index
Int32

O local do índice baseado em zero em que o cabeçalho da coluna é inserido.

strtext
String

O texto a ser exibido no cabeçalho da coluna.

width
Int32

A largura inicial do cabeçalho da coluna. Defina como -1 para dimensionar automaticamente o cabeçalho da coluna para o tamanho do maior texto subitem da coluna ou -2 para dimensionar automaticamente o cabeçalho da coluna para o tamanho do texto do cabeçalho da coluna.

textAlign
HorizontalAlignment

Um dos HorizontalAlignment valores.

Exceções

index é menor que 0 ou maior ou igual ao valor da Count propriedade do ListView.ColumnHeaderCollection.

Comentários

Esta versão do Insert método permite que você crie uma nova ColumnHeader configuração de alinhamento de texto, largura e texto do cabeçalho de coluna específica e insira-a em uma posição específica no ListView.ColumnHeaderCollection. Você pode usar esse método se quiser inserir um novo cabeçalho de coluna em uma coleção existente de cabeçalhos de coluna. Se você quiser usar um existente ColumnHeader e inseri-lo em uma posição específica na coleção, use a outra versão do Insert método. Para adicionar um cabeçalho de coluna sem especificar uma posição específica na coleção, use o Add método. Se você quiser adicionar uma matriz de cabeçalhos de coluna à coleção, use o AddRange método.

Confira também

Aplica-se a

Insert(Int32, String, String, Int32)

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s

Cria um novo cabeçalho de coluna com o texto, a chave e a largura especificados e insere o cabeçalho na coleção no índice especificado.

public:
 void Insert(int index, System::String ^ key, System::String ^ text, int width);
public void Insert(int index, string key, string text, int width);
member this.Insert : int * string * string * int -> unit
Public Sub Insert (index As Integer, key As String, text As String, width As Integer)

Parâmetros

index
Int32

O local do índice baseado em zero em que o cabeçalho da coluna é inserido.

key
String

O nome do cabeçalho da coluna.

text
String

O texto a ser exibido no cabeçalho da coluna.

width
Int32

A largura inicial, em pixels, do cabeçalho da coluna.

Comentários

Para adicionar um cabeçalho de coluna sem especificar uma posição na coleção, use o Add método. Se você quiser adicionar uma matriz de cabeçalhos de coluna à coleção, use o AddRange método.

A Name propriedade corresponde à chave de uma coluna no ListView.ColumnHeaderCollection.

Aplica-se a

Insert(Int32, String, String)

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s

Cria um novo cabeçalho de coluna com o texto e a chave especificados e insere o cabeçalho na coleção no índice especificado.

public:
 void Insert(int index, System::String ^ key, System::String ^ text);
public void Insert(int index, string key, string text);
member this.Insert : int * string * string -> unit
Public Sub Insert (index As Integer, key As String, text As String)

Parâmetros

index
Int32

O local do índice baseado em zero em que o cabeçalho da coluna é inserido.

key
String

O nome do cabeçalho da coluna.

text
String

O texto a ser exibido no cabeçalho da coluna.

Comentários

Para adicionar um cabeçalho de coluna sem especificar uma posição na coleção, use o Add método. Se você quiser adicionar uma matriz de cabeçalhos de coluna à coleção, use o AddRange método.

A Name propriedade corresponde à chave de uma coluna no ListView.ColumnHeaderCollection.

Aplica-se a

Insert(Int32, String, Int32)

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s

Cria um novo cabeçalho de coluna com o texto especificado e a largura inicial e insere o cabeçalho na coleção no índice especificado.

public:
 void Insert(int index, System::String ^ text, int width);
public void Insert(int index, string text, int width);
member this.Insert : int * string * int -> unit
Public Sub Insert (index As Integer, text As String, width As Integer)

Parâmetros

index
Int32

O local do índice baseado em zero em que o cabeçalho da coluna é inserido.

text
String

O texto a ser exibido no cabeçalho da coluna.

width
Int32

A largura inicial, em pixels, do cabeçalho da coluna.

Comentários

Para adicionar um cabeçalho de coluna sem especificar uma posição na coleção, use o Add método. Se você quiser adicionar uma matriz de cabeçalhos de coluna à coleção, use o AddRange método.

Aplica-se a

Insert(Int32, ColumnHeader)

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s

Insere um cabeçalho de coluna existente na coleção no índice especificado.

public:
 void Insert(int index, System::Windows::Forms::ColumnHeader ^ value);
public void Insert(int index, System.Windows.Forms.ColumnHeader value);
member this.Insert : int * System.Windows.Forms.ColumnHeader -> unit
Public Sub Insert (index As Integer, value As ColumnHeader)

Parâmetros

index
Int32

O local do índice baseado em zero em que o cabeçalho da coluna é inserido.

value
ColumnHeader

A ColumnHeader inserção na coleção.

Exceções

index é menor que 0 ou maior ou igual ao valor da Count propriedade do ListView.ColumnHeaderCollection.

Comentários

Esta versão do Insert método permite que você insira um existente ColumnHeader em uma posição específica no ListView.ColumnHeaderCollection.

Se você quiser criar um novo ColumnHeader e inseri-lo em uma posição específica na coleção, use a outra versão do Insert método. Para adicionar um cabeçalho de coluna sem especificar uma posição específica na coleção, use o Add método. Se você quiser adicionar uma matriz de cabeçalhos de coluna à coleção, use o AddRange método.

Confira também

Aplica-se a

Insert(Int32, String)

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s
Origem:
ListView.ColumnHeaderCollection.cs

Cria um novo cabeçalho de coluna com o texto especificado e insere o cabeçalho na coleção no índice especificado.

public:
 void Insert(int index, System::String ^ text);
public void Insert(int index, string text);
member this.Insert : int * string -> unit
Public Sub Insert (index As Integer, text As String)

Parâmetros

index
Int32

O local do índice baseado em zero em que o cabeçalho da coluna é inserido.

text
String

O texto a ser exibido no cabeçalho da coluna.

Exceções

index é menor que 0 ou maior ou igual ao valor da Count propriedade do ListView.ColumnHeaderCollection.

Comentários

Para adicionar um cabeçalho de coluna sem especificar uma posição na coleção, use o Add método. Se você quiser adicionar uma matriz de cabeçalhos de coluna à coleção, use o AddRange método.

Aplica-se a